首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PowerShell SQL脚本USP和用户

PowerShell是一种跨平台的脚本语言和命令行工具,用于自动化任务和配置管理。它结合了命令行的灵活性和脚本语言的功能,可用于管理操作系统、网络设备、云服务等。

SQL脚本是一种用于操作和管理关系型数据库的脚本语言。它可以用于创建、修改和查询数据库中的表、视图、存储过程等对象,以及插入、更新和删除数据。

USP是指用户存储过程(User Stored Procedure),是一种在数据库中存储的可重复使用的代码块。它可以接受输入参数并返回结果,用于执行复杂的数据库操作和业务逻辑。

PowerShell可以通过调用SQL脚本和USP来实现与数据库的交互和操作。通过PowerShell的脚本编写和执行能力,可以自动化执行SQL脚本和USP,实现批量操作和定时任务。

PowerShell和SQL脚本的优势在于:

  1. 自动化和批量操作:PowerShell可以编写脚本来执行SQL脚本和USP,实现自动化和批量操作,提高效率和减少人工错误。
  2. 灵活性和可扩展性:PowerShell具有丰富的语法和功能,可以与其他系统和服务进行集成,实现更复杂的操作和管理任务。
  3. 跨平台支持:PowerShell已经支持在Windows、Linux和macOS等多个平台上运行,可以在不同的环境中使用相同的脚本进行管理和操作。
  4. 强大的数据库操作能力:SQL脚本和USP是专门用于数据库操作的语言,可以实现高效的数据查询、修改和管理。

PowerShell和SQL脚本的应用场景包括但不限于:

  1. 数据库管理:通过PowerShell调用SQL脚本和USP,可以进行数据库的备份、还原、优化和监控等管理操作。
  2. 数据迁移和同步:使用PowerShell编写脚本,调用SQL脚本和USP,可以实现不同数据库之间的数据迁移和同步。
  3. 自动化测试:通过PowerShell编写脚本,调用SQL脚本和USP,可以实现数据库的自动化测试,验证数据库的正确性和性能。
  4. 数据分析和报表生成:通过PowerShell编写脚本,调用SQL脚本和USP,可以实现数据的提取、转换和加载,用于数据分析和报表生成。

腾讯云提供了一系列与数据库和云计算相关的产品,可以与PowerShell和SQL脚本结合使用,实现更强大的功能和性能。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,如MySQL、SQL Server等。链接:https://cloud.tencent.com/product/cdb
  2. 云数据库 Redis:提供高性能、可扩展的云原生内存数据库服务,用于缓存、会话存储等场景。链接:https://cloud.tencent.com/product/redis
  3. 云数据库 MongoDB:提供高性能、可扩展的云原生文档数据库服务,用于存储和查询非结构化数据。链接:https://cloud.tencent.com/product/cosmosdb
  4. 云数据库 TDSQL:提供高性能、可扩展的云原生分布式数据库服务,用于大规模数据存储和查询。链接:https://cloud.tencent.com/product/tdsql

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 SCCM Intune 部署 Windows 11 硬件就绪 PowerShell 脚本

您可以使用 SCCM 中的运行脚本选项来获取 Windows 11 硬件就绪脚本的实时输出。 对于 Intune,不需要部署此 PowerShell 脚本。...您可以下载PowerShell 脚本来手动测试。 我确实在几台 PC 上运行了这个 Windows 11 硬件准备脚本。您可以从以下屏幕截图脚本输出中看到失败或无法运行的 结果。...在“主页”选项卡的“创建”组中,单击“ 创建脚本” 。 在创建脚本向导的脚本页面上,配置以下设置: 输入 脚本名称 并选择脚本语言作为 PowerShell。...单击NEXT、NEXTClose按钮​​继续。 image.png image.png 您可以选择名为Windows 11 Readiness Script的脚本,然后单击下一步继续。...您还将获得脚本执行详细信息: 脚本名称:Windows 11 就绪脚本 脚本类型:PowerShell 集合 ID:MEM00020 此集合中有 2 个资源。将通知在线客户尽快运行脚本

2K30

四十六.PowershellPowerSploit脚本攻防万字详解

这篇文章将详细讲解PowerShellPowerSploit脚本攻击,进一步结合MSF漏洞利用来实现脚本攻击防御。希望这篇文章对您有帮助,更希望帮助更多安全攻防或红蓝对抗的初学者,且看且珍惜。...Nishang基于PowerShell的渗透测试专用工具,集成了框架、脚本各种Payload,包含下载执行、键盘记录、DNS、延时命令等脚本。...,它内置在Windows 7版本及其以上的系统中,使命令行用户脚本编写者可以利用 .NET Framework的强大功能。...NoProfile(-NoP):PowerShell控制台不加载当前用户的配置文件 Noexit:执行后不退出Shell,这在使用键盘记录等脚本时非常重要 再次强调,PowerShell脚本在默认情况下无法直接执行...Get-GPPPassword.ps1 检索通过组策略首选项推送的帐户的明文密码其他信息 Get-GPPAutologon.ps1 如果通过组策略首选项推送,则从registry.xml检索自动登录用户密码

22510

SQL Server检索SQL用户信息的需求

如下SQL,可以找到当前SQL Server跑过的SQL,但是没用户信息, SELECT p.refcounts, p.usecounts, sqltext.text  FROM sys.dm_exec_cached_plans...view=sql-server-ver15 但是能sys.dm_exec_sql_text关联起来的只有database_id,如下得到的应该是个笛卡尔积,并未将SQLlogin_name用户的信息关联起来...' THEN 'RangeI_S(RangeI_N S 转换锁)' WHEN 'RangeI_U' THEN 'RangeI_U(RangeI_N U 转换锁)' WHEN 'RangeI_X'...' THEN 'RangeX_U(RangeI_N RangeS_U 转换锁)' WHEN 'RangeX_X' THEN 'RangeX_X(排他键范围排他资源锁)' ELSE a....无论从监控粒度,还是数据统计的角度,SQL用户信息关联检索还是有用的,可以做到更精细的控制,不太清楚为什么微软官方没给出这样的设计,或者有其他隐藏的功能?

1.2K30

默认用户密码(SQL)

IRIS® 数据平台提供了用于登录数据库开始使用的默认用户密码。默认用户名为“_SYSTEM”(大写),密码为“sys”。...SQLCODE错误代码(SQL)执行大多数 SQL操作都会发出SQLCODE值。发出的SQLCODE值为0、100负整数值。 SQLCODE=0表示SQL操作成功完成。...保留字(SQL)SQL保留字列表。...该列表仅包含在此意义上保留的那些单词;它不包含所有SQL关键字。上面列出的几个单词以"%"字符开头,表示它们是 SQL专有扩展关键字。...通常,不建议使用以"%"开头的单词作为表名列名等标识符,因为将来可能会添加新的 SQL扩展关键字。可以通过调用IsReserve vedWord()方法来检查某个字是否为SQL保留字,如下例所示。

5.2K10

【数据库设计SQL基础语法】--用户权限管理--用户权限管理

一、标题SQL权限概述 SQL权限是指在关系数据库管理系统(RDBMS)中,对数据库对象(如表、视图、存储过程等)进行访问操作的权力。...SQL权限是数据库安全性和数据保护的关键组成部分,它确保只有经过授权的用户可以执行特定的数据库操作,以维护数据的完整性保密性。...SQL权限通常涉及以下几个方面: 数据库级别权限: 控制用户对整个数据库的访问权限。这包括创建数据库、备份还原等操作。...二、SQL用户角色 2.1 什么是用户角色 在数据库管理系统(DBMS)中,用户角色是一种组织管理权限的机制。角色是一组权限的集合,可以赋予给用户,而用户则成为该角色的成员。...通过限制用户SQL语句的执行权限,可以防止潜在的滥用非法访问。以下是一些SQL语句执行权限管理的关键原则示例: SELECT权限: 目标: 控制用户对表的查询权限。

42710

16.CCS19 针对PowerShell脚本的轻量级去混淆语义感知攻击检测(经典)

恶意代码检测论文总结及抽象语法树(AST)提取 [AI安全论文] 16.CCS2019 针对PowerShell脚本的轻量级去混淆语义感知攻击检测(经典) 一.InforSec作者分享的学习笔记 InforSec...实验显示,通过解混淆,我们可以将混淆后脚本原始脚本之间的相似度从仅0.5%提高到了近80%。...所以,解混淆后的脚本不但能较好地进行恶意性检测,其本身逻辑语义分析也比较清晰,从而能进行针对性保护。 6.结论 最后总结,我们针对攻击者常用工具PowerShell的混淆难题。...该方法在 PowerShell 脚本的抽象语法树(Abstract Syntax Tree)中的子树级别执行混淆检测基于仿真的恢复。...一个恶意脚本混淆去混淆后AST效果图如下所示: 此外,第五部分详细介绍了语义感知攻击检测工作。

74940

【每日SQL打卡】​​​​​​​​​​​​​​​DAY 3丨行程用户【难度困难】

难度困难 SQL架构 Trips 表中存所有出租车的行程信息。每段行程有唯一键 Id,Client_Id Driver_Id 是 Users 表中 Users_Id 的外键。...每个用户有唯一键 Users_Id。Banned 表示这个用户是否被禁止,Role 则是一个表示(‘client’, ‘driver’, ‘partner’)的枚举类型。...语句查出 2013年10月1日 至 2013年10月3日 期间非禁止用户的取消率。...基于上表,你的 SQL 语句应返回如下结果,取消率(Cancellation Rate)保留两位小数。...取消率的计算方式如下:(被司机或乘客取消的非禁止用户生成的订单数量) / (非禁止用户生成的订单总数) +------------+-------------------+ |     Day    |

31120

SQL面试题库」 No_15 行程用户

我每天发布1道SQL面试真题,从简单到困难,涵盖所有SQL知识点,我敢保证只要做完这100道题,不仅能轻松搞定面试,代码能力工作效率也会有明显提升。...巩固SQL语法,高效搞定工作:通过不断练习,能够熟悉SQL的语法常用函数,掌握SQL核心知识点,提高SQL编写能力。代码能力提升了,工作效率自然高了。...SQL题目的难度不一,需要在一定时间内解决问题,培养了我们对问题的思考能力、解决问题的能力对时间的把控能力等。...2、今日真题 题目介绍: 行程用户 trips-and-users 难度困难 SQL架构 Trips 表中存所有出租车的行程信息。...取消率的计算方式如下:(被司机或乘客取消的非禁止用户生成的订单数量) / (非禁止用户生成的订单总数) sql +------------+-------------------+ | Day

28330

MySQL下执行sql脚本以及数据的导入导出

执行sql脚本,可以有2种方法: 第一种方法: 在命令行下(未连接数据库),输入 : mysql -h localhost -u root -proot < /itoffer_new.sql 注意路径不用加引号的...,且Windows系统下目录为\,Linux下为/ ,注意区分,另外注意执行脚本用户和数据库,回车即可。...第二种方法: 在命令行下(已连接数据库,此时的提示符为 mysql> ),输入: source /itoffer_new.sql ? 执行完成之后查看表: ? 执行成功!!!...MySQL数据的导出导入: 1.远程数据库(表)导出到本地数据库(表)文件 (1)导出数据库 将192.168.1.1主机上的mydb数据库导出到本地的mydb.bak文件中: mysqldump..., 则使用 chown mysql:mysql /tmp/a.txt 将该文件的所属设为mysql用户,再次执行上面的命令则一般可以完成导入。

4.3K20

hive sql(三)—— 求所有用户活跃用户的总数及平均年龄

需求 求所有用户活跃用户的总数及平均年龄 建表语句 create table user_age( dt string, user_id string, age int ) row..._c3 0 0.0 2 19.00 3 27.0 0 0.00 分析 1、这里有两次去重,第一次去重是一个用户一天内多次访问,只算一次,第二次一个用户有多个连续登录,那么实际情况中,第一次去重是常规操作...,第二次去重根据公司实际要求来做 2、活跃用户是指连续两天及以上,所以count(*)>=2 3、date_sub(dt,rank) flag这个是核心逻辑,语言不好描述,举例说明:(03-22,1)(...03-27,2),(03-28,3),(03-29,4),通过日期相减后得到的值都是结果是03-21,03-25,只有03-25的结果是日期是连续的 4、这里需要计算所有用户的平均年龄活跃用户的平均年龄...,维度不同,在不同的列展示,而union all需要保证列数相同,所以这里需要补默认值 扩展 min(age)作用: 1、满足分组时把age从子查询带出 2、用户每天登录,年龄可能会随着日期变化,所以潜在的计算规则中是每次根据用户日期分组时取最小年龄

97920

Windows AD域通过组策略设置域用户登录注销脚本

首先准备一个测试脚本 test.bat,输出当前用户机器名到一个文件里,内容如下 echo %COMPUTERNAME% >> c:\test\test.log echo %USERNAME% >>...在“组策略管理编辑器”左侧导航树上选择 “Default Domain Policy” -> 用户配置 -> 策略 -> Windows 设置 -> 脚本(登录/注销) 双击 “登录”,在 “登录” 属性中添加上面的脚本...这里可以先在属性窗口的下部使用“显示文件”来查看默认脚本文件都放在什么地方,比如,在我的环境下是: 登录脚本路径 \\\sysvol\\Policies\{31B2F340...-016D-11D2-945F-00C04FB984F9}\User\Scripts\Logoff 将上面的脚本放入上面的位置,然后确定。...“注销” 脚本 “登录” 脚本类似。 最后,在客户机上使用任意域用户登录系统,就可以看到在c:\test\目录下产生的日志文件。

3.8K80

蠕虫病毒“柠檬鸭”持续扩散 多种暴破方式攻击用户电脑

“LemonDuck”通过多种暴破方式(SMB暴破,RDP暴破,SQL Server暴破)漏洞(USBLnk漏洞,永恒之蓝漏洞)传播。病毒入侵用户电脑后,会执行木马下载器PowerShell脚本。...PowerShell命令行 下载得到的PowerShell下载器脚本(经过去混淆后)如下图所示: ? 去混淆后的脚本 下载器木马脚本的主体功能为下载执行挖矿模块病毒传播模块。...并将木马下载器js脚本flashplayer.tmp放入不同用户的%APPDATA%目录下, 并将启动快捷方式flashplayer.lnk放到不同用户的开机启动目录中。 ?...RDP暴破传播 3) SQL Server暴破 病毒会暴破SQL Server数据库,暴破成功后,执行远程命令行下载执行恶意PowerShell脚本,并把暴破成功的主机信息(包括版本, IP地址, 密码等...SQL Server暴破传播 4) USBLnk漏洞传播: 病毒会在主机的移动硬盘网络硬盘中创建快捷方式相应的dll。

1.6K40

人人都值得学一点PowerShell实现自动化(2)有哪些可用的场景及方式?

同样地,因为PowerShell是跨平台的语言工具,在MACLinux上也可以使用,具体能否在这些系统上做运维就不得而知了。...Azure上使用PowerShell真实场景 分享一点点笔者真实的项目应用,使用PowerShell对Azure的Azure SQLAzure AS的资源开关升降自动化。...因笔者使用了Azure SQLAzure AS两项服务,用于PowerBI的项目中,通过资源的开关升降操作,可以为企业节省出不少的Azure消耗费用,非常有实际推广价格。...同样地在Azure AS分析服务供用户查询报表时使用,提供底层的计算能力,也因为用户只会在上班时间才有必要开通此服务,在节假日下班时间,可以关闭。...使用CMD或PowerShell控制台执行 可以在控制台上引用文件路径,也可以执行PowerShell脚本。 此处需要在脚本文件前加个点号。

1.8K20
领券